Blood Money Stakes Postponed Until 2026

Harness racing at Connell Park Raceway in Woodstock, N.B.

The Blood Money Stakes for two-year-old pacing colts and fillies sired by Blood Money, which was originally scheduled for earlier this summer at Connell Park Raceway in Woodstock, N.B., will be contested in 2026.

With the tragic events of June 14th at Connell Park Raceway, the stakes calendar required adjustments to accommodate various paid in events. 

"As such, the only available free day for this event is Nov. 1," stated a release from Horse Racing New Brunswick. "It is felt the season has been long enough and as such, the event will be contested at Connell Park Raceway in 2026."  

Only those two-year-olds who raced and earned money will be considered eligible for the event with the same conditions applying (top seven money earners from either sex).
